What is CrossFit?
CrossFit is defined as:
Constantly varied functional movement executed at high intensity.
Let’s break that down:
- ✅ Constantly Varied: Every workout is different to keep your body adapting.
- ✅ Functional Movements: Think squats, pulls, presses, running, jumping—movements that prepare you for real life.
- ✅ High Intensity: This doesn’t mean “all-out” every day; it means working at a challenging, sustainable pace for your level.
What Does a Typical Class Look Like?
Most classes have two parts:
1️⃣ Strength Piece – Focused on building strength with squats, presses, deadlifts, or Olympic lifts, with plenty of rest between sets.
2️⃣ Metcon (Metabolic Conditioning) – Combining cardio and strength into a high-intensity workout.
What’s the Philosophy Behind CrossFit?
CrossFit is built on The 100 Words of Fitness, a simple guide to eating, training, and living well.
💬 “Eat meat and vegetables, nuts and seeds, some fruit, little starch, and no sugar. Keep intake to levels that will support exercise but not body fat.”
The variety, functional movements, and intensity combined with smart nutrition is what gets results—whether your goal is fat loss, strength, or better overall health.
